University of Puerto Rico at Arecibo reported $418 thousand of research and development spending in FY2024, ranking #831 of the 925 institutions in the survey. That is up 13.0% on FY2023's $370 thousand; its national rank was down 4 places. Federal government is its largest funding source at 81.8% ($342 thousand), followed by institution funds at 18.2%. Its largest field of research is geosciences, atmospheric sciences, and ocean sciences, $267 thousand or 63.9% of the total.
